Bomb Attacks At 2 Petrol Stations In South

PATTANI, BANGKOK
Two petrol stations were damaged by bombs in two districts of this southern border province on Tuesday night, and one employee was injured.
Police said a bomb was detonated at 8.05pm at a PTT station on Highway 42 in Moo 7 village in tambon Bana of Muang district. A petrol station attendant was injured and sent to hospital. The station is located near Pattani Bus Terminal.
Eyewitnesses at the PTT station said two men arrived on a motorcycle and planted a bomb there. One of them then fired a gun into the air and yelled at the attendants to flee before detonating the bomb.
The other bomb went off at a PT petrol station on Highway 42 in tambon Piya Mumang of Yaring district.
Police were investigating.
